Output ae24be61a898d0f1fc71049f3696dba549dfbdcb928f336e627ed1f232272081:1

value
10580704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b72835f8ec919d086c80ca61cb4fcfd1d0f66a OP_EQUAL
address
35Vb3PJeX6g8Nh935A9Z4MhUnBQ1vrY62w
transaction
ae24be61a898d0f1fc71049f3696dba549dfbdcb928f336e627ed1f232272081
spent
true